Abstract

The aim of this study is to evaluate the effect of low frequency ultrasound plus lymphatic drainage on blood triglycerides in cardiac patients (chronic coronary atherosclerosis patients with high triglycerides and fat mass body composition. Forty female patients with age ranges from 40 to 50 years were selected from Palestine hospital and they were chronic atherosclerotic patients and were assigned into 2 groups according to their BMI based on the classification of the world health organization. Each patient in the two groups (Group A and Group B) was evaluated before and after 24 sessions treatment program by using the combination of ultrasound and lymphatic drainage machine. The assessment of blood serum triglycerides by UDICHEM-310 ANALYSER have been done before and after the end of 24 sessions and Re-assessment after 2 months from the last treatment session. The collected raw data of the current patients were statistically analyzed to evaluate the results of the two groups to investigate the effect of using the combination of ultrasound and lymphatic drainage machine on blood serum triglycerides. In this study, the results are revealed statistically significant improvement of blood serum triglycerides before and after the treatment with more improvement had been achieved after 2 months after last session. Furthermore, the low frequency ultrasound technique plus lymphatic drainage technique improve blood serum triglycerides of chronic coronary atherosclerosis patients with high triglycerides and fat mass composition.
